USRP Software Defined Radio Reconfigurable Device
-
The USRP Software Defined Radio Reconfigurable Device is built on the LabVIEW reconfigurable I/O (RIO) and universal software radio peripheral (USRP) architectures. It includes a powerful FPGA for advanced DSP that you can program with the LabVIEW FPGA Module. The device includes 2x2 MIMO transceivers or four-channel superheterodyne receivers, supporting center frequencies from 10 MHz to 6 GHz, with up to 160 MHz of instantaneous bandwidth. The USRP Software Defined Radio Reconfigurable Device also optionally includes a GPS‐disciplined oven-controlled crystal oscillator (GPSDO), which provides greater frequency accuracy than temperature- compensated crystal oscillators. Prototyping applications include LTE and 802.11 prototyping, spectrum monitoring, signals intelligence, military communications, radar, direction finding, and wireless research.

Boundary Scan Test
-
Boundary Scan is a very useful tool for quick, low-cost, re-usable powered-up test of an assembly for basic functionality. Because a fixture with test probes is not required, it is possible to have a working test available within hours or days, rather than weeks. Designers can receive rapid feedback on their prototype boards with tests that can be used again during production testing, as well as for device programming. Given power, ground and Tap port signals, tests can be written to assess the performance of the boundary scan enabled parts on an assembly and other parts on the boundary scan chain.

PXIe-5764, 16-Bit, 1 GS/s, 4-Channel PXI FlexRIO Digitizer
785169-01
FlexRio Digitizer
The PXIe-5764 is a PXI FlexRIO Digitizer that simultaneously samples four channels at 1 GS/s with 16 bits of resolution and features 400 MHz of analog input bandwidth. With up to 70 dB of SNR, the PXIe-5764 is ideal for applications that require a wide dynamic range with a wideband digitizer. The FlexRIO driver includes support for finite and continuous streaming modes, and you can implement custom algorithms and real-time signal processing on the LabVIEW-programmable Xilinx Kintex UltraScale FPGA. Available in AC and DC coupled variants, the PXIe-5764 is ideal for both time and frequency domain applications, including radar prototyping, LIDAR, communications, microscopy, OCT, event detection, and particle physics.

Flying Probe Tester
Condor MTS 505
-
Primarily the Flying Probe Tester was developed to enable In-Circuit testing (ICT) of prototype PCBs. For testing a new design an existing fixture has to be changed or a new fixture has to be procured. The fixtureless design of the MTS 505 Condor is one of its most attractive properties, where the unnecessary and costly time delays incurred for fixture build or changes can be avoided. It is the ideal platform for testing prototypes.

PXIe-5775, 12-Bit, 6.4 GS/s, 2-Channel PXI FlexRIO Digitizer
785591-01
FlexRio Digitizer
The PXIe-5775 is a PXI FlexRIO Digitizer that provides 6 GHz of AC-coupled analog bandwidth and 12 bits of resolution. You can operate the PXIe-5775 in a dual-channel mode at 3.2 GS/s or in a single-channel interleaved mode at 6.4 GS/s. With a passband from 1 MHz to more than 6 GHz, the PXIe-5775 is ideal for high-bandwidth frequency domain applications, including radar prototyping, LIDAR, and communications. The FlexRIO driver includes support for finite acquisition, and you can implement custom algorithms and real-time signal processing on the LabVIEW-programmable Xilinx Kintex UltraScale FPGA.

PXI-8516, 2-Port PXI LIN Interface Module
781366-01
LIN Interface
2-Port PXI LIN Interface Module—The PXI‑8516 is a Local Interconnect Network (LIN) interface for developing applications with the NI‑XNET driver.The PXI‑8516 excels in applications requiring real-time, high-speed manipulation of hundreds of LIN frames and signals, such as hardware-in-the-loop simulation, rapid control prototyping, bus monitoring, automation control, and more. The NI‑XNET device-driven DMA engine enables the onboard processor to move LIN frames and signals between the interface and the user program without CPU interrupts, minimize message latency, and free host processor time for processing complex models and applications.
